What is FAFSA Verification Form
The 2015-2016 FAFSA Verification Worksheet is a financial aid verification form used by dependent students and their parents to verify information on the FAFSA.

Who Needs the 2 FAFSA Verification Worksheet?
The 2 FAFSA Verification Worksheet is essential for students classified as dependent, requiring at least one parent's signature. Generally, those selected for verification by their financial aid office will need to complete this worksheet to confirm their information.
It is crucial for both students and parents to understand when this form is required, as it plays a significant role in eligibility confirmation for financial aid. Awareness of these requirements can prevent delays in the aid process.
Required Documents for the 2 FAFSA Verification Worksheet
To complete the 2 FAFSA Verification Worksheet successfully, certain documentation is necessary. Commonly required documents include tax returns, W-2 forms, and other supporting financial materials.
-
Tax returns for the previous year
-
W-2 forms from employers
-
Proof of untaxed income, if applicable
Organizing these documents in advance is critical for a smooth completion of the worksheet. Accurate documentation is not only necessary for verification but also helps in avoiding any complications during the aid process.

Who is eligible to use the FAFSA Verification Worksheet?
This worksheet is primarily for dependent students and their parents who need to verify their financial information reported on the FAFSA for the 2015-2016 academic year.
What are the deadlines for submitting this form?
Submission deadlines may vary based on the school’s financial aid requirements. Check with your college’s financial aid office for specific timeframes to ensure timely processing.
How do I submit the FAFSA Verification Worksheet?
You can submit the completed worksheet by providing it to your school's financial aid office. Some schools may allow electronic submissions, so check their preferences.
What supporting documents do I need to attach?
Along with the worksheet, you may need to attach relevant financial documents like tax returns or W-2 forms to verify the information reported.
What common mistakes should I avoid when filling out this form?
Ensure that all sections are completed correctly, double-check for accuracy, and make sure all required signatures are included before submitting to avoid processing delays.
How long does it take to process the FAFSA Verification Worksheet?
Processing times can vary by institution. Typically, it may take several weeks after submission to receive confirmation or updates regarding your financial aid.
